Noun

mistigri (uncountable)

  1. A trick-taking card game that dates back to the 18th century, somewhat resembling poker.

French

Etymology

From Old French miste ‘playful name for cat’ + gris 'grey'.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/mis.ti.ɡʁi/
  • (file)

Noun

mistigri m (plural mistigris)

  1. (archaic) cat, malkin
  2. Jack of Clubs
